Spiritual transformation is not about forcing change but inviting God’s work within us to unfold naturally. As highlighted in Ephesians 4:20-24, the journey begins when we stop trying to hold on to our former selves—those old identities and habits that no longer serve our growth—and instead embrace the new self created to reflect God’s righteousness and holiness. Each day offers a fresh opportunity to shed what feels restrictive or misaligned with your true identity. This process often starts with recognizing the parts of your life and mindset that do not resonate with your spiritual purpose. By consciously surrendering these outdated patterns in prayer, you create space for truth rooted in God’s Word to guide your transformation. Renewal from within involves a heart and mind shift—choosing to respond from maturity and faith rather than wounds or past conditioning. It’s about embodying the identity that God always envisioned for you: grounded, whole, and growing steadily in grace. When you feel that your old self ‘‘no longer fits,’’ it’s a divine nudge to move forward into your higher purpose. This inner renewal aligns closely with the Holy Spirit’s guidance, encouraging believers not to perform transformation but to allow it. Transformation is a relational experience, inviting you to listen deeply to God’s whispers and follow his lead without resistance. Many find it helpful to identify one habit or belief that they feel called to release. Journaling about these changes, surrendering them during prayer, and replacing those thoughts with affirmations from scripture can reinforce this new identity. For example, replacing self-doubt with verses that affirm your belovedness in Christ strengthens your walk with renewed confidence. Ultimately, growth begins the moment you move beyond rehearsing your former identity and step fully into the person God created you to be. Spiritual renewal from within is a profound journey of letting go, stepping up, and living into the life that heaven always knew was possible for you.
